501(c)(3) Status

Tax-Exempt Determination

The Foundation for Infrastructure Resilience, Inc. is recognized by the Internal Revenue Service as a tax-exempt organization under Section 501(c)(3) of the Internal Revenue Code. All donations to FIR are deductible to the fullest extent permitted by law.

Transparency & Governance

FIR is committed to the transparency standards expected of a public charity operating in the national security space. The framework is published, not paywalled. The threat assessment series is sourced exclusively from public documents. The Fresh Start assessment is free. BSE 099 is free. Bronze certification costs nothing. FIR does not gate critical preparedness information behind a paywall.
